深度解析:服务器端口翻译,助力网络畅通无阻
服务器端口翻译

首页 2024-06-25 18:50:50



服务器端口翻译:技术原理与实际应用 在计算机网络通信中,服务器端口扮演着至关重要的角色,它是信息传输的通道,是服务器与外部世界沟通的桥梁

    端口翻译则是这一通信过程中不可或缺的一环,它确保了数据的准确传输和服务的有效提供

    本文将从技术原理和实际应用两个层面,深入探讨服务器端口翻译的相关知识

     一、服务器端口的基本概念 在计算机网络中,端口是通信端点的抽象表示,用于标识和定位不同的服务或应用程序

    每个端口都对应一个唯一的数字标识符,称为端口号

    服务器端口则是服务器上用于监听和响应客户端请求的特定端口

    常见的服务器端口包括HTTP服务的80端口、FTP服务的21端口等

     二、端口翻译的技术原理 端口翻译,也称为端口映射或端口转发,是一种在网络中改变数据包目标端口号的技术

    其基本原理是在网络设备的转发过程中,将数据包的目标端口号从一个值更改为另一个值

    这一过程通常发生在路由器、防火墙或负载均衡器等网络设备中

     端口翻译的主要作用包括: 1. 隐藏真实端口:通过端口翻译,可以将服务器的真实端口号隐藏起来,提高服务器的安全性

    外部用户只能看到翻译后的端口号,而无法直接访问服务器的真实端口

     2. 解决端口冲突:当多个服务需要使用相同的端口号时,端口翻译可以帮助解决端口冲突的问题

    通过将不同的服务映射到不同的端口号,确保每个服务都能够正常运行

     3. 负载均衡:在大型网络环境中,端口翻译可以与负载均衡技术结合使用,将客户端的请求分发到多个服务器上,提高系统的整体性能和可靠性

     三、端口翻译的实际应用 端口翻译在计算机网络通信中具有广泛的应用场景,以下列举几个典型的例子: 1. 远程访问:在家庭或小型办公网络中,用户可能希望通过互联网远程访问内部的服务器或设备

    此时,可以在路由器上设置端口翻译规则,将外部访问的特定端口映射到内部服务器的对应端口上,从而实现远程访问功能

     2. 虚拟专用网络(VPN):VPN技术通过在网络之间建立加密通道来实现远程安全访问

    在VPN的设置过程中,通常需要配置端口翻译规则,以确保加密数据的正确传输和访问控制

     3. Web服务器配置:对于运行Web服务的服务器而言,端口翻译可以用于将标准的HTTP端口(如80端口)映射到服务器上实际运行的Web服务端口

    这样,用户就可以通过标准的HTTP端口访问Web服务,而无需知道服务器的实际端口配置

     4. 游戏服务器:许多在线游戏需要玩家连接到特定的游戏服务器进行游戏

    通过端口翻译,游戏服务器可以将游戏端口映射到公网IP上的某个端口,方便玩家连接

     四、总结与展望 服务器端口翻译作为网络通信中的关键技术之一,为数据的准确传输和服务的有效提供提供了有力保障

    随着网络技术的不断发展和应用的不断深化,端口翻译技术将在更多领域得到应用

    未来,我们可以期待端口翻译技术在安全性、灵活性和智能化方面取得更大的突破,为网络通信带来更加便捷和高效的体验

     同时,对于网络管理员和开发人员而言,深入理解和掌握端口翻译的原理和应用也是必不可少的

    通过合理配置和管理端口翻译规则,可以提高网络的安全性和稳定性,为用户提供更加优质的服务体验